Heirloom books are more than just reading material; they are cherished artifacts that connect us to our past. These books often carry stories, memories, and lessons that have been passed down through generations, making them invaluable in the realm of Psychology & Relationships. When you hold an heirloom book, you are not just engaging with its content; you are embracing the legacy of those who came before you.
Many families find joy in sharing these books, using them as conversation starters or as tools for teaching younger generations about their heritage. The act of reading an heirloom book can foster deeper relationships, as it encourages discussions about family history, values, and shared experiences.
Here are some reasons why heirloom books hold such a special place in our hearts:
- Connection: They create a bond between generations, allowing stories to be shared and preserved.
- Learning: Heirloom books often contain wisdom and lessons that are relevant across time.
- Tradition: Passing down a book can be a family tradition that reinforces identity and values.
- Memory: They serve as tangible reminders of loved ones and significant life events.
